@media only screen and (min-width: 200px) and (max-width: 767px){
    .container{
        width: 100%;
        flex-direction: column;
        
        
    }
    .container1{
        width: 100%;
        flex-direction: column;
        
    }
    .container2{
        width: 100%;
        flex-direction: column;
       
    }
    .container3{
        width: 100%;
        flex-direction: column;
        
    }
    .container4{
        width: 100%;
        flex-direction: column;
        
    }
    .container5{
        flex-direction: column;
        
    }
    .container6{
        width: 100%;
        flex-direction: column;
        
    }

    .container7{
        width: 100%;
        flex-direction: column;
      
    }
    .container8{
        width: 100%;
        flex-direction: column;
       
    }
    .container9{
        width: 100%;
        flex-direction: column;
    
    }
    .progress-container{
        width: 100%;
        flex-direction: column;
       
    }
    .container11{
        width: 100%;
        flex-direction: column;
    }
    .container12{
        width: 100%;
        flex-direction: column;
        
    }
    .container13{
        width: 100%;
      
       
    }
    .box18{
        width: 100%;
        
        flex-direction: column;

    }

    .box12{
        padding-right: 500px;
    }
    body{
        width: 100%;
        flex-direction: column;
    }
    header{
        width: 100%;
        
    }
}